Account of Plate Left my Daughter, Mary Grainger.
1 Doz. Table Knives & forks, Silver Handles.
1 Doz. Desart Ditto Silver Handles.
1 Silver Butter Boat,
1 Do. Tea pott.
1 Ditto Milk Pot.
1 Dz Silver Salts & Shovels.
1 Silver Salver.
1 Set of Casters with Silver Tops.
1 Soop Spoon, Silver
Half a Dozen Silver Table Spoons, Tea Spoons
August 23d., 1760.
Caleb Grainger.
Test.
Joshua Former.
Thos. Wright.
(Turn Over) As it will be of no Real Service to my Friends,
the giving of Scarfs &c (I desire that I be Buried in a Decent
Manner and as a Mason), with a Plain Blacked Coffin, not
Covered with Cloth, And that my Dear and ever Worthy Friend
Mr. Corn. Harnett have purchased out of my Estate a neat
Mourning Ring which I begg he may wear in remembrance of
his Sinciar Friend & Brother,
Caleb Grainger.
Feb'ry 16th., 1761.
Be it knowTi unto all men by these presents, that I, Caleb
Grainger, of New Hanover County, in the Province of North
Carolina, Gentleman, have made a declared that my Last Will
& Testament In Writing bearing date the day of in
the year of our Lord, One thousand and Seven hundred and
sixty three to which said will, this Codicil is annexed.
I, the said Caleb Grainger, Do by these presents Codicil,
Confirm & ratify my said Last Will and do give & bequeath
unto the Child My wife, Mary Grainger, is now Pregnant with
whether it be a Male or a female, his, or her heirs & Assigns
forever, all my Moiety of the Land on Smiths Creek adjacent
to the Saw Mill & Grist Mill now building by my friend, Cor-nelius
Harnett & mysell, together with a proportionate part
(with the rest of my children), of my personal Estate. It is
also my Will that the said Saw mill, to wit, my Moiety, be com-pleated
& finished by by Executors out of the Proffits of my
Estate ; the proffits arising from the said Mills, to go to the use
of my Estate until the said child come of age or day of Marriage;
and my will is that this Codicil be adjudged a part of my said
Will.
